Top Five: Kate Boutique

Love it or hate it, most of you will agree that Keira Knightley has a pretty quirky fashion sense. I'm definitely a fan, and of course, have been stalking her footwear. A few times she's been spotted wearing a pair of sandals which bear an uncanny resemblance to Kate Boutique's J.P. & Mattie Clair leather sandals. At US$126 they're pretty expensive but they aren't metallic for once, which definitely gets the thumbs up from me! They are the first of my top five - carry on to see what else is available!

First up are these delicate Alessandra Sandalia cobra gold sandals by Super Suite Seventy Seven -I'm not sure that I generally view having cobra snake skin wrapped around my feet to be terribly chic and glam, but these really are beautiful. They feature a solid leather band which crisscrosses and fastens at the ankle, and the heel is 3 3/4 inches high. Even better is the fact that they're reduced from US$290 to US$149, although this does mean that sizes are selling out fast!

Next up, as I continue my quest to find red shoes that aren't trashy and tacky in any way, are Pedro Garcia's red Damaris Satin Poppy heels. Featuring a 3.5 inch heel and a rough-hewn satin fringe, you'll even get an extra pair of rubber studs for your heels when you part with your hard-earned US$288. The website seems pretty confident about how comfortable they are to wear which is always good news, and recommends putting them with narrow cropped jeans or, my favourite suggestion, a white eyelet dress (and tan).

I'm also a fan of this simple pair of French Sole flats, available for US$98. I do love French Sole shoes, and although black or brown suede flats aren't too practical on a gorgeously hot day like today, they're always useful to have - especially as an easy and comfortable way to make a pair of skinny jeans sexy yet casual.

Finally, take a look at these 'Natasha' platform cobra natural wedges from Super Suite Seventy Seven. They're reduced from US$364 to US$182 and have a 4 1/4 inch platform, although the overall lift is 1 inch making it 3 1/4 inches. The sandals also, rather excitingly, have metallic gold trim in the cobra skin giving them a slightly quirky colour. I'm not usually a fan of wedges but I do like these - what do you think?
